public interface IZOrderManager extends IItemListener
Modifier and Type | Method and Description |
---|---|
void |
bringToTop(IItem item)
Bring to top.
|
int |
getItemZOrder()
Gets the item z order.
|
int |
getZCapacity()
Gets the z capacity.
|
void |
ignoreItemClickedBehaviour(IItem item)
Ignore item clicked behaviour.
|
void |
notifyChildZCapacityChanged(IItem itemBeingManaged,
IZOrderManager defaultZOrderManager)
Notify child z capacity changed.
|
void |
registerForZOrdering(IItem item)
Register for z ordering.
|
void |
sendToBottom(IItem item)
Send to bottom.
|
void |
setAutoBringToTop(boolean enabled)
Sets the auto bring to top.
|
void |
setBringToTopPropagatesUp(boolean should)
Sets the bring to top propagates up.
|
void |
setItemZOrder(int zValue)
Sets the item z order.
|
void |
setZCapacity(int c)
Sets the z capacity.
|
void |
unregisterForZOrdering(IItem i)
Unregister for z ordering.
|
void |
updateOrder()
Update order.
|
itemCursorChanged, itemCursorClicked, itemCursorPressed, itemCursorReleased, itemMoved, itemRotated, itemScaled, itemVisibilityChanged, itemZOrderChanged
void bringToTop(IItem item)
item
- the itemint getItemZOrder()
int getZCapacity()
void ignoreItemClickedBehaviour(IItem item)
item
- the itemvoid notifyChildZCapacityChanged(IItem itemBeingManaged, IZOrderManager defaultZOrderManager)
itemBeingManaged
- the item being manageddefaultZOrderManager
- the default z order managervoid registerForZOrdering(IItem item)
item
- the itemvoid sendToBottom(IItem item)
item
- the itemvoid setAutoBringToTop(boolean enabled)
enabled
- the new auto bring to topvoid setBringToTopPropagatesUp(boolean should)
should
- the new bring to top propagates upvoid setItemZOrder(int zValue)
zValue
- the new item z ordervoid setZCapacity(int c)
c
- the new z capacityvoid unregisterForZOrdering(IItem i)
i
- the ivoid updateOrder()